Zoned U-C-2 (Upland Conservation/Resource Management), the parcel allows one single-family dwelling by right, along with general agriculture, animal husbandry, crop farming, and recreational uses. Additional uses may be available by use permit. The listing notes the parcel sits within a mile of BLM land and has sightlines toward Spanish Springs Peak and Observation Peak.
At approximately 879,912 square feet, this workable parcel is presented for activities such as grazing, dry farming, hunting, camping, or a rural homestead.
